Suggest a better descriptionIn large bowl, whisk together flour, sugar, baking powder, baking soda, salt, and nutmeg. Stir in chocolate chips and toffee bits. In a separate bow. whisk together the vanilla, melted butter, eggs, pumpkin and water. Make a well in the dry ingredients, fill it with the liquid ingredients, and mix vigorously until everything is well blended. Spoon the batter into lightly greased or paper lined cups of a 12 cup muffin pan. Bake at 350 for 25 to 30 minutes or until a cake tester inserted into the center comes out clean. Remove from oven and let cool for 5 minutes. Remove from pan and cool completely. When cool stir together glaze ingredients and dip each muffin top into the glaze. Store in air tight container.
